<title>mac80211: Switch to a virtual time-based airtime scheduler</title>

This switches the airtime scheduler in mac80211 to use a virtual
time-based scheduler instead of the round-robin scheduler used before.
This has a couple of advantages:

- No need to sync up the round-robin scheduler in firmware/hardware with
  the round-robin airtime scheduler.

- If several stations are eligible for transmission we can schedule both
  of them; no need to hard-block the scheduling rotation until the head
  of the queue has used up its quantum.

- The check of whether a station is eligible for transmission becomes
  simpler (in ieee80211_txq_may_transmit()).

The drawback is that scheduling becomes slightly more expensive, as we
need to maintain an rbtree of TXQs sorted by virtual time. This means
that ieee80211_register_airtime() becomes O(logN) in the number of
currently scheduled TXQs because it can change the order of the
scheduled stations. We mitigate this overhead by only resorting when a
station changes position in the tree, and hopefully N rarely grows too
big (it's only TXQs currently backlogged, not all associated stations),
so it shouldn't be too big of an issue.

To prevent divisions in the fast path, we maintain both station sums and
pre-computed reciprocals of the sums. This turns the fast-path operation
into a multiplication, with divisions only happening as the number of
active stations change (to re-compute the current sum of all active
station weights). To prevent this re-computation of the reciprocal from
happening too frequently, we use a time-based notion of station
activity, instead of updating the weight every time a station gets
scheduled or de-scheduled. As queues can oscillate between empty and
occupied quite frequently, this can significantly cut down on the number
of re-computations. It also has the added benefit of making the station
airtime calculation independent on whether the queue happened to have
drained at the time an airtime value was accounted.

<title>mac80211: add rx decapsulation offload support</title>

This allows drivers to pass 802.3 frames to mac80211, with some restrictions:

- the skb must be passed with a valid sta
- fast-rx needs to be active for the sta
- monitor mode needs to be disabled

mac80211 will tell the driver when it is safe to enable rx decap offload for
a particular station.

In order to implement support, a driver must:

- call ieee80211_hw_set(hw, SUPPORTS_RX_DECAP_OFFLOAD)
- implement ops-&gt;sta_set_decap_offload
- mark 802.3 frames with RX_FLAG_8023

If it doesn't want to enable offload for some vif types, it can mask out
IEEE80211_OFFLOAD_DECAP_ENABLED in vif-&gt;offload_flags from within the
.add_interface or .update_vif_offload driver ops

<title>mac80211: fix incorrect strlen of .write in debugfs</title>

This fixes strlen mismatch problems happening in some .write callbacks
of debugfs.

When trying to configure airtime_flags in debugfs, an error appeared:
ash: write error: Invalid argument

The error is returned from kstrtou16() since a wrong length makes it
miss the real end of input string.  To fix this, use count as the string
length, and set proper end of string for a char buffer.

The debug print is shown - airtime_flags_write: count = 2, len = 8,
where the actual length is 2, but "len = strlen(buf)" gets 8.

Also cleanup the other similar cases for the sake of consistency.
